A fee proposal, also known as a fee quote or fee estimate, is a formal document outlining the costs associated with a specific service or project. It's a crucial aspect of business transactions, ensuring both parties are clear about the financial expectations. Let's delve into the definition, importance, and key components of a fee proposal.

In essence, a fee proposal is a written agreement between a service provider and a client, detailing the services to be rendered and the corresponding charges. It serves as a blueprint for the financial aspect of the project, helping to manage expectations and avoid misunderstandings.

Understanding Fee Proposals

Fee proposals are common in various industries, from legal and financial services to creative and consulting fields. They are typically prepared by the service provider, outlining their understanding of the client's needs and how they plan to meet those needs.

Understanding fee proposals is vital for both parties. For service providers, it's about communicating the value of their services effectively. For clients, it's about making informed decisions and budgeting appropriately.

Purpose of Fee Proposals

Fee proposals serve several purposes. Firstly, they clearly state the scope of work, ensuring both parties are on the same page. They also break down the costs, making it easier for clients to understand what they're paying for. Moreover, they can serve as a legal document, protecting both parties' interests.

In some cases, fee proposals can also be used as a marketing tool. A well-crafted proposal can showcase the provider's understanding of the client's needs, their expertise, and their commitment to customer service.

Elements of a Fee Proposal

A comprehensive fee proposal includes several key elements. Firstly, it should clearly identify the client and the service provider. It should then outline the scope of work in detail, including any assumptions or exclusions.

The proposal should also detail the pricing structure. This could be a flat fee, hourly rate, or a combination of both. It's important to explain how the fees were calculated to build trust with the client. Finally, the proposal should include terms and conditions, such as payment schedule and confidentiality clauses.

Crafting an Effective Fee Proposal

Crafting an effective fee proposal requires a balance of professionalism and personalization. It's about demonstrating your expertise while showing empathy for the client's needs and budget.

Here are some tips for creating an effective fee proposal. Firstly, understand the client's needs and tailor the proposal to address those needs. Be clear and concise in your language, avoiding jargon that the client might not understand. Also, be transparent about your pricing, explaining why your fees are justified.

Tips for Pricing Your Services

Pricing your services can be challenging. It's important to consider your costs, the value you bring to the client, and what the market will bear. Researching industry standards can help you price competitively.

Remember, your fee proposal is not just about the money. It's about building a relationship with the client. So, be open to negotiation and willing to discuss alternative pricing structures if necessary.

In closing, a well-crafted fee proposal is a powerful tool for service providers. It communicates your value, builds trust with the client, and sets the stage for a successful business relationship. So, take the time to craft a proposal that truly reflects the quality of your services. And remember, the goal is not just to win the client's business, but to start a conversation that leads to a long-term partnership.
